Council Decision
of 10 July 2012
appointing six Bulgarian members and eight Bulgarian alternate members of the Committee of the Regions
(2012/403/EU)
THE COUNCIL OF THE EUROPEAN UNION,
Having regard to the Treaty on the Functioning of the European Union, and in particular Article 305 thereof,
Having regard to the proposal of the Bulgarian Government,
Whereas:
Six members’ seats on the Committee of the Regions have become vacant following the end of the terms of office of Ms Katya DOYCHEVA, Ms Dora IANKOVA, Mr Orhan MUMUN, Ms Penka PENKOVA, Mr Georgi SLAVOV and Mr Bozhidar YOTOV. Six alternate members’ seats have become vacant following the end of the terms of office of Mr Ivo ANDONOV, Ms Shukran IDRIZ, Mr Veselin LICHEV, Mr Rumen RASHEV, Mr Svetlin TANCHEV and Mr Nayden ZELENOGORSKI. Two alternate members’ seats will become vacant following the appointment of Mr Ahmed AHMEDOV and Mr Krassimir KOSTOV as members of the Committee of the Regions,
HAS ADOPTED THIS DECISION:
Article 1
The following are hereby appointed to the Committee of the Regions for the remainder of the current term of office, which runs until 25 January 2015:
- (a)
as members:
Mr Ahmed AHMEDOV, Mayor, Municipality of Tsar Kaloyan
Ms Tanya HRISTOVA, Mayor, Municipality of Gabrovo
Mr Krassimir KOSTOV, Mayor, Municipality of Shumen
Mr Madzhid MANDADZHA, Mayor, Municipality of Stambolovo
Mr Zhivko TODOROV, Mayor, Municipality of Stara Zagora
Mr Luydmil VESSELINOV, Mayor, Municipality of Popovo,
and
- (b)
as alternate members:
Mr Nida AHMEDOV, Mayor, Municipality of Kaolinovo
Mr Ivan ALEKSIEV, Mayor, Municipality of Pomorie
Mr Atanas KAMBITOV, Mayor, Municipality of Blagoevgrad
Ms Kornelia MARINOVA, Municipal Councillor, Municipality of Lovech
Ms Sebihan MEHMED, Mayor, Municipality of Krumovgrad
Ms Anastassya MLADENOVA, Municipal Councillor, Municipality of Peshtera
Mr Fahri MOLAYSSENOV, Mayor, Municipality of Madan
Mr Georgi SLAVOV, Mayor, Municipality of Yambol.
Article 2
This Decision shall enter into force on the day of its adoption.
